Samsung Galaxy Note 3, Galaxy Gear smartwatch to launch in India today

Samsung is all set to launch the Galaxy Note 3 and Galaxy Gear smartwatch in India today. The company is running a live webcast of the launch as well which you can catch here. We will be live-blogging the event as well. The launch event will begin at 12.15 pm. While the device will be showcased in India today, it will only hit the stores on 25 September. Samsung has also opened up pre-orders for the Samsung Galaxy Note 3 and the Galaxy Gear smartwatch. Users can pay an advance payment of Rs 2,000 for pre-booking the device. Samsung is also offering Galaxy Note 3 with the Galaxy Gear smartwatch at the same pre-booking price. Of course, the actual price of both devices is going to be much higher than Rs 2000. The Note 3 could be priced higher than Rs 45,000 and closer to Rs 50,000. According to BGR.in which looked at the source code of Saholic the price of the phablet would be Rs 47,990. The Galaxy Gear smartwatch which was launched for $299 could cost close to Rs 19,000 in India or it could be priced higher as well. The Galaxy Note 3 has a 5.7-inch full HD Super AMOLED display. It will be available in 32GB and 64GB versions, along with an additional microSD card slot. It has 3GB RAM, a 13 megapixel rear camera with Smart Stabilization and high CRI LED flash. [caption id=“attachment_1113623” align=“alignleft” width=“380”]Samsung Galaxy Gear and Galaxy Note 3 in this file photo. Getty Images Samsung Galaxy Gear and Galaxy Note 3 in this file photo. Getty Images[/caption] The device supports the latest LTE technologies, which the company claims, supports the greatest number of multiple frequencies. It runs on Android 4.3 (Jelly Bean). India is likely to get the Octa-core version of the smartphone. As far as the Galaxy Gear is concerned it has a 1.63 inch Super AMOLED display with 320 x 320 pixel resolution. The processor is 800 MHz and the smartwatch comes with 512 MB RAM and 4GB memory space. It has a 1.9 megapixel camera on the strap. The camera has BSI Sensor, Auto Focus and the ability to record and shoot videos as well. It has two microphones, ( 1 noise cancelling) and a speaker as well. The watch supports Bluetooth 4.0 and sensors on the watch are accelerometer and gyroscope. In terms of dimensions the watch is 36.8 x 56.6 x 11.1 mm, weighs 73.8g. It has a Li-ion 315mAh battery.

America ready for self-driving cars, but it has a legal problem

US self-driving cars may soon ditch windshield wipers as the NHTSA plans to update regulations by 2026. State-level rules vary, complicating nationwide deployment. Liability and insurance models are also evolving with the technology.
